Passionate leadership : creating a culture of success in every school

By: Thomas-EL, SalomeContributor(s): Jones, Joseph | Vari,T.JMaterial type: TextTextPublication details: California Corwin 2020Description: xxvii,184pISBN: 9781544345697 Subject(s): Educational leadership | School management and organization | School environmentDDC classification: 371.2 Summary: Have you fallen into a rut? Has your position become simply a "role" or a "job?" The authors of this book will remind you why education, the most important profession in our society, demands passionate leadership. Passionate Leadership is an aspiring call to action for teachers and principals around the world to recommit to passionately serving children, building the communities children deserve, and celebrating our successes. Take ownership, push to new heights, and break old boundaries by following the strategies in this book. Discover Practical ideas and suggestions for how to serve as a beacon of hope in the field First-hand experiences from enthusiastic leaders modeling what passionate leadership looks like Charts and graphs that will help you assess your strong points and identify areas you can improve on Student success and growth begin with leaders who commit to taking courageous action!
